Open Settings on Apple TV, then Go to Users and Accounts > Home Sharing. Turn on Home Sharing, then enter your Apple ID and password. To configure your devices, do any of the following: Configure a Mac with macOS Ventura: On your Mac, choose Apple menu > System Settings, click General in the sidebar, then click Sharing.

Mirror a Mac screen on Apple TV: On the Mac, do either of the following:. Mac with macOS Big Sur or later: Click Control Center in the menu bar, click Screen Mirroring , then choose the name of the Apple TV you want to use. To end screen mirroring, click Control Center in the menu bar, click Screen Mirroring , then click the name of the Apple TV.. Mac with …Dec 27, 2020 ... Home videos in your iCloud Photos Library can be watched in the Photos app. Home videos in the Library of the Apple TV app (or iTunes application) on a networked computer can be Home Shared, and watched in the Computers app (Home Videos tab) on the Apple TV box. This is the same for any model Apple TV …The same Apple ID must be used to enable Home Sharing to stream media content from your computer(s) to Apple TV (2nd generation). You can stream from more than one computer to Apple TV as long as all computers use the same Apple ID for Home Sharing. Family Sharing lets you and up to five other family members share access to amazing Apple services like Apple Music, Apple TV+, Apple News+ and Apple Arcade. Your group can also share iTunes, Apple Books and App Store purchases, an iCloud storage plan and a family photo album.
